Genre: electronica, sample-based, dance, club, hip-hop

The biggest single in M|A|R|R|S' career was the only single in their career, the highly influential "Pump Up The Volume". People had never quite heard of a song full of samples from other songs, even though the collage-style of production was something made famous by Double Dee & Steinski and other DJ's and producers. This disc is the U.S. version on 4th & B'Way/Island with mixes that may be different from the UK disc.

Alternative Rock, Shoegaze | Label: Cherry Red Records

This 5xCD box set from Cherry Red offers a compelling look at shoegaze's prime era. Still in a Dream takes a wide trawl approach to its genre, which has upsides and downsides. As with Rhino’s goth box A Life Less Lived, shoegaze is generously interpreted to include antecedents and formative influences, which bulks up the quality.

If the past is a foreign country, Miles Kane has a green card for the 1960s, so firmly does his musical vision reside in that time. Where his work with Alex Turner as the Last Shadow Puppets was hailed for its reimagining of Scott Walker-style grandeur, his solo debut sees the decade through a magpie's eye. Jaunty Motown harmonies (Quicksand) are juxtaposed with pulse-raising rock'n'roll riffs (Come Closer) calling to mind everyone from the Stooges to the Supremes. Kane's textures are eclectic, with string sections and slide guitars to bolster his best crooning on the title track, and the breathy vocals of French actress Clmence Posy on the spacious rhythm and blues of Happenstance. Each retro touch is accompanied by the big choruses and key changes of a man who knows his way around a pop song, even if he's not out to break new ground just yet.

During the latter half of the 1980s, a wave of alternative artists began to explore a gentler, more ethereal sound, bringing a dream-like aesthetic to the rock and pop idiom. Taking its lead from the UK (and the 4AD label in particular), this refined approach soon spread, particularly to the United States, slowly picking up the moniker “dream pop” – a catch-all term rather than a genre within itself.
Curated by the same team as our successful ‘Still In A Dream’ 2016 shoegaze set, ‘Cherry Stars Collide’ explores that sound as it emerged in the mid-80s and proceeded to define a less grounded, more thoughtful approach to musical expression than was offered elsewhere. Fusing and blending with other genres along the way. – from the guitar driven shoegaze movement and proto-Britpop to the post ‘C-86’ generation and the nascent leftfield clubbing scene – that sound both drew in artists already operating elsewhere and inspired new artists to embark their own journey.
